你如何看待无代码运动?

2021-12-06 10:00:55 +08:00
 moremoney

这些应用程序 /平台使非开发人员能够解决一堆原本需要软件工程师的问题,这是范式转变吗?

无代码工具生成的代码总是更复杂,因为它包含了无代码开发环境 + 设计工具 + 解释器或运行时 + 集成器 + 实际生成的代码。如果出了问题,所有部分可能都需要排查。

无代码工具最好只用来生成原型产品。当你确切想清楚想要什么,再找程序员将它写出来,这样可能更快,有利于以后的升级和排查。

14514 次点击
所在节点    程序员
108 条回复
cmdOptionKana
2021-12-06 10:34:21 +08:00
只会复制黏贴的程序员,可取代性高是当然的啊,总不能水平低还想吃铁饭碗吧,如果这行饭这么容易吃饱,就算没有“无码技术”,也会有数以亿计的新人进入行业参与竞争,对吧?

而技术高的程序员,难道还怕无码?

到了无码技术能取代技术大佬的程度,做梦都会笑醒,因为那时人类的科技该多么发达,生产力多么高,受惠的将会是全人类。
guyuesh2
2021-12-06 10:37:31 +08:00
好像在 ruanyifeng 大神的 blog 上看见过主题的这句话.

原文: https://www.ruanyifeng.com/blog/2021/12/weekly-issue-186.html
原文: https://news.ycombinator.com/item?id=29191068
liuidetmks
2021-12-06 10:41:05 +08:00
@clf 我感觉,很多需求不需要那么深入,很多深度定制的需求是伪需求。
就像 Excel 一个 vlookup 满足 80%需求,其他功能没啥用
greyforestforest
2021-12-06 10:43:04 +08:00
#20 +1 游戏行业很多“可视化”工具把 AI ,技能丢给策划,那配置起来还不如让策划学一下脚本呢
zw1one
2021-12-06 10:52:41 +08:00
不是程序员不会用,是程序员不屑用。
fredli
2021-12-06 10:55:04 +08:00
业务驱动型,和技术无关
auh
2021-12-06 10:55:14 +08:00
进一步缩短想法和实现的距离。不过这个东西有点距离。
cnrting
2021-12-06 10:59:14 +08:00
裤子都脱了你就让我看这个?
CoCoMcRee
2021-12-06 11:15:32 +08:00
10 年前各大 开发工具纷纷推出图形化可视化拖拽控件, 并且大吹特吹的时候, 彼时彼刻像不像此时此刻?
Jooooooooo
2021-12-06 11:16:02 +08:00
有人意识不到写代码这个环节在整个业务需求迭代中占的比重并不大.
FakNoCNName
2021-12-06 11:16:11 +08:00
如果把无代码比作搭积木,那需要足够丰富的模具(现成的代码模块)才行。

这跟写具体代码又不一样,涉及到前后端交互的话更复杂,搞不懂吹这个概念的。

记得 15 年那会儿接触过一款好像叫 nodered 的平台,也就适合做做原型涉及吧,不知道现在怎么样了。
youxiachai
2021-12-06 11:21:02 +08:00
@CoCoMcRee 同感...这个无代码,都发展了十几年了...也不知道为啥好像都当新鲜事物来宣传
youxiachai
2021-12-06 11:21:42 +08:00
@FakNoCNName node-red 在 iot 领域活得好好的
shyrock
2021-12-06 11:21:43 +08:00
不看好。
古老技术用新名词封装一下而已。

如果用户真的有自定义的需求,从信息论的角度来说,无论采用何种开发语言、或者是 scratch 、BPMN 等图形载体,这些定制信息的存储、传递所需的数据量有一个压缩极限,复杂度是始终存在的。
这决定了,所谓的‘无代码’只是换了一个新的方言进行编程。大部分实际情况是,这种新方言功能强大,但是需要接近与编程语言的学习时间来学习并掌握;或者为了降低学习成本,新方言仅包含很少的原语、仅支持非常有限的功能。

作为例子,SAP 的 ERP 软件就号称不用编码实现很多客户自定义的需求,但是实际上是内置的海量流程和功能,让人用海量的配置来选择。
kaifeiji
2021-12-06 11:22:53 +08:00
只有形成了标准化的行业,低代码、无代码才有市场
公司内部尝试过低代码开发平台,最后被各种需求锤爆。
结果就是:把需求拆分成配置项,配置项多到眼花,最后比写代码还累。
kidult
2021-12-06 11:30:42 +08:00
巨硬微微一笑
steptodream
2021-12-06 11:34:19 +08:00
我看成了无码运动 还纳闷真的有人喜欢看有码的
ChefIsAwesome
2021-12-06 11:47:49 +08:00
给不识字的人语音输入法,是不是文盲也当作家?
把 xyz 换成甲乙丙,是不是人人都能学好数理化?
给后端一个 dreamweaver ,是不是前端就要下岗了?

难道程序员觉得自己跟非程序员的区别就是:1 、掌握 if else 这些英文; 2 、熟悉括号和缩进?
silencil
2021-12-06 11:56:41 +08:00
脱裤子放屁--纯属多此一举!
JudyHal
2021-12-06 12:02:04 +08:00
看着大家气愤的样子,不由让我想起了卢德运动里的卢德分子,太像了。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/820257

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X